    This is a matter of pharmacokinetics. Each pharmacological entity has its own pharmacokinetic profile. Pharmacokinetics tells us how a particular drug/chemical is absorbed, distributed, metabolised and excreted in the body. The pharmacokinetic profile of Ethylmercury is very different to that of Methylmercury. Ethylmercury (in Thimerosal) is much more rapidly excreted and does not accumulate in the body when compared to Methylercury.
    This is similar to the difference between Ethanol and Methanol. Both are what we commonly call alcohol. The pharmacokinetics are very different (even though for all intents and purposes they are the same substance). If you had Methanol instead of Ethanol in your pint of beer, you’d be in hospital very quickly.
